#1?NEGLECT MARKET RESEARCH?
The market is precarious, changing?fast, and has dynamic business activity. Therefore it is important to dig into #research to study the #location,?the?#target #audience, and your business idea before launching your #eCommerce business.?Additionally,?try to find similar eCommerce businesses and compare your?business to your?#competition.?A #market #research helps?you understand and identify the changes in your?target market. Enhancing your?#market #awareness?minimizes?the risk factor, and most importantly, gives you?a holistic picture of market trends.
#2 POOR PAYMENT GATEWAY?
Not only is the #customer searching for a great product on your website, but also, they are looking for a?#professional?service such as a simple and?secure payment?process. The #payment #gateway that you?pick?for your #eCommerce site ought to build?a?trustworthy experience?for?your customers as they?purchase.
In 2018, a report published by cybersecurity firm Shape Security stated that?80% to 90%?of the login attempts made at online a retailers’?eCommerce are hackers using stolen data.
#3 NEGLECTING OPTIMIZING YOUR WEBSITE FOR MOBILE USERS
According to Cyber Monday?($9.2 billion?in online revenue in 2019), 54% of visitors came from mobile devices, while around 33% purchased on their mobile device, up over 40% from the year before.
Therefore,?not only is?creating a mobile-friendly website design?extremely essential?for?driving more?#sales, but also?helps?your business?SEO-ranking?improvement.

#4?LACK OF A?BRAND IDENTITY?
One of the most common business mistakes is starting an eCommerce?website without paying attention to #brand #identity or message. The quality of the product must be united with a strong identity which makes it unique and one of a kind in the market. To create a booming eCommerce?business, you will need to construct a strong?brand identity.?
As mentioned above, if you conduct sufficient #market #research,?you should?have a strong idea?on the needs?of your?#target #audience. Accordingly, you know?how to approach them. Focus on matching your logo?to?the business idea, pay attention to the tone of the content, and never belittle?the?importance of?your email address format.
Having a solid brand identity increments client dependability and your potential for broad brand awareness.?
#5 "NOT SECURE" WARNING?
Last, but not least, the?“Not Secure”?warning?pop-up message is a red flag for any new customer visiting your #eCommerce website.
One of the most crucial elements in any #eCommerce?website is securing the transactions and the process of collecting sensitive data,?such as banking data and personal information.?Google formally endorses securing websites with HTTPS,?since it is not only significant for business owners, who need their websites to perform sufficiently but?also?to increase traffic.
